Donald A. E. Beer (May 31, 1935 – January 25, 1997) was an American competition rower from Massachusetts, and Olympic champion.

He received a gold medal in eights with the American rowing team at the 1956 Summer Olympics in Melbourne.[1] The eight rowers were Yale undergraduates. Beer was a member of the Class of 1957.[2]
